Associate’s Student Diversity

For the most recent academic year available, 39% of liberal arts & humanities associate’s degrees went to men and 61% went to women.

Kalamazoo Valley Community College gender breakdown of Liberal Arts & Humanities Associate's degree grads The majority of liberal arts & humanities associate’s degree graduates at Kalamazoo Valley Community College are White. Approximately 70% of graduates fell into this category.

The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from Kalamazoo Valley Community College with a associate’s in liberal arts & humanities.

Ethnic diversity of Liberal Arts & Humanities majors at Kalamazoo Valley Community College
Ethnic Background Number of Students
Asian 12
Black or African American 39
Hispanic or Latino 26
White 308
Non-Resident Aliens 3
Other Races 51
